Our support amazes me sometimes on 14:39 - Aug 31 by Yppswyche | We’ve likely hit our FFP ceiling for the price of players that would improve the squad, so the only way to get the requisite quality in currently is via loans, as our saleable assets won’t reach full potential valuation until they’ve had a decent season in the championship. Come next summer and we sell Leif & Broadhead for instance for a combined £20M+ say and we then have the wiggle room, which other championship clubs have this summer thru this scenario, to invest more broadly across the squad in terms of permanent first team additions to move us up to the next level. The owners have the money but not the possibility to use it. As others have said the prem loan market in the championship is a vital cog in all the leagues clubs ability to add quality they wouldn’t otherwise be able to afford. This is nothing new, to us or any other club.. have folks lost their heads? By the same logic Aluko signing on for another year is a good deal, as to buy in someone of his general quality & experience who knows the system and would be happy to play a bit part role would cost cash we don’t have room to use for that role in the team.
